MySQL多实例主从库搭建指南

资源类型:e4bc.com 2025-07-24 20:22

mysql多个实例 主从库简介:



MySQL多实例主从库:高效、安全的数据库架构方案 在当今的大数据时代,数据库的性能和稳定性对于企业的信息系统至关重要

    MySQL作为广泛使用的开源关系型数据库管理系统,其灵活性和可扩展性得到了广泛认可

    为了满足不断增长的数据处理需求和提高系统的容错能力,构建MySQL多个实例的主从库架构成为了众多企业的首选方案

     一、MySQL多实例的必要性 随着业务的发展和数据量的激增,单一的MySQL实例往往难以满足高并发、大数据量的处理需求

    多实例架构通过部署多个MySQL实例,能够有效地分担负载,提高系统的整体性能和吞吐量

    此外,多实例架构还能提供更好的容错性,当某个实例出现故障时,其他实例可以继续提供服务,从而确保业务的连续性

     二、主从库架构的优势 在主从库架构中,通常将一个MySQL实例配置为主库(Master),负责处理写操作,而将其他实例配置为从库(Slave),负责处理读操作

    这种架构具有以下显著优势: 1.读写分离:通过将读操作和写操作分散到不同的实例上,可以显著提高数据库的整体性能

    写操作通常对资源消耗较大,而读操作则相对较轻

    通过读写分离,可以确保写操作不会干扰到读操作的性能,从而实现更高效的数据处理

     2.数据备份与恢复:从库可以实时复制主库的数据,这样在主库发生故障时,可以迅速将从库提升为主库,以减少系统停机时间

    此外,从库还可以用于数据备份和恢复,提高数据的安全性

     3.扩展性:随着业务的发展,可以方便地增加更多的从库实例,以满足不断增长的数据处理需求

    这种水平扩展的方式不仅可以提高系统的吞吐量,还能保持系统的稳定性和可用性

     三、实施步骤与注意事项 在实施MySQL多实例主从库架构时,需要注意以下几个关键步骤: 1.环境准备:确保服务器硬件和网络环境满足多实例部署的要求

    考虑到性能和安全性,建议采用高性能的服务器和稳定的网络环境

     2.实例规划:根据业务需求和数据量大小,合理规划主库和从库的数量

    通常情况下,一个主库可以搭配多个从库,以实现负载均衡和高可用性

     3.配置与部署:按照MySQL的官方文档进行实例的配置和部署

    确保主从库之间的网络连接畅通,并正确设置复制参数

     4.测试与验证:在部署完成后,进行详细的测试和验证

    包括性能测试、稳定性测试以及数据一致性测试等

    确保主从库之间的数据同步准确无误

     5.监控与维护:定期对数据库进行监控和维护,包括检查复制状态、优化查询性能、处理异常情况等

    确保系统长期稳定运行

     四、案例分析与实际效果 以某电商平台为例,该平台在发展过程中遇到了数据库性能瓶颈

    通过引入MySQL多实例主从库架构,成功实现了读写分离和数据备份

    在实际运行中,该架构显著提高了系统的吞吐量和响应速度,同时降低了单点故障的风险

    在高峰期,系统能够平稳应对大量的读写请求,保证了用户体验和业务的连续性

     五、结论与展望 MySQL多实例主从库架构是一种高效、安全的数据库解决方案

    通过读写分离、数据备份与恢复以及方便的水平扩展性,该架构能够满足企业在数据处理和容错方面的需求

    在实际应用中,企业应根据自身业务特点和数据量大小进行合理规划和部署,以确保系统的稳定性和高效性

    展望未来,随着技术的不断发展,我们期待更多创新的数据库架构方案出现,以满足日益增长的数据处理需求

    

阅读全文
上一篇:Python智能助力:一键自动备份MySQL数据库

最新收录:

  • MySQL存储过程执行结果解析与应用指南
  • Python智能助力:一键自动备份MySQL数据库
  • MySQL客户端连接数据库失败?排查指南来了!
  • MySQL箭头加分:数据库性能提升新技巧
  • MySQL查询存储过程名称技巧
  • MySQL数据库字段值递增技巧:轻松实现加1操作
  • MySQL8手册全解析:掌握数据库新特性与优化技巧
  • CMD删除MySQL教程:轻松卸载步骤
  • 基于MySQL的数据统计:解锁数据价值的秘诀
  • 无MySQL安装?解决方案来了!
  • MySQL表关联困境:ID匹配失效,数据无影踪?
  • MySQL数据库运维核心指标解析
  • 首页 | mysql多个实例 主从库:MySQL多实例主从库搭建指南